The Society For Biomaterials
is a professional society which promotes advances in all phases of materials research and development by encouragement of cooperative educational programs, clinical applications, and professional standards in the biomaterials field.

2008/2009 SFB Board of Directors

During the 2008 World Biomaterials Congress held in Amsterdam, Netherlands, a new Board of Directors was installed:

Jeffrey Hubbell – President
Lynne Jones – President-Elect
Alan Litsky – Secretary/Treasurer
Antonios Mikos – Secretary/Treasurer-Elect
Julia Babensee – Member-at-Large
Martine LaBerge – 1st Past President
C. Mauli Agrawal – 2nd Past President
